Fifa World Cup 2022 and Gini Coefficient up to the Round of Sixteen

Authors: Anindya Kumar Biswas

In this paper we study the Fifa World Cup 2022 matches up to the Round of Sixteen. We find that the empirical evidence of lower Gini coefficient is continuing to decide the higher probability of winning of a country in a match in the FIFA World Cup 2022up to the Round of Sixteen. Moreover, in the Group Stage, probability to win with lower HDI was 18/37 or, 1/2.06 i.e. less than half. In the Round of Sixteen stage probability to win with lower HDI has swung to the opposite direction to 5/8 i.e. more than half, as in the previous World Cup.
